Signed-off-by: Fernando Fernandez Mancera <[email protected]>
---
net/ipv4/netfilter/Kconfig | 2 +-
net/ipv6/netfilter/Kconfig | 2 +-
net/netfilter/Kconfig | 4 ++++
net/netfilter/Makefile | 1 +
4 files changed, 7 insertions(+), 2 deletions(-)
diff --git a/net/ipv4/netfilter/Kconfig b/net/ipv4/netfilter/Kconfig
index 1412b029f37f..87f6ec800e54 100644
--- a/net/ipv4/netfilter/Kconfig
+++ b/net/ipv4/netfilter/Kconfig
@@ -197,7 +197,7 @@ config IP_NF_TARGET_SYNPROXY
tristate "SYNPROXY target support"
depends on NF_CONNTRACK && NETFILTER_ADVANCED
select NETFILTER_SYNPROXY
- select SYN_COOKIES
+ select NF_SYNPROXY
help
The SYNPROXY target allows you to intercept TCP connections and
establish them using syncookies before they are passed on to the
diff --git a/net/ipv6/netfilter/Kconfig b/net/ipv6/netfilter/Kconfig
index 086fc669279e..f71879f875e1 100644
--- a/net/ipv6/netfilter/Kconfig
+++ b/net/ipv6/netfilter/Kconfig
@@ -213,7 +213,7 @@ config IP6_NF_TARGET_SYNPROXY
tristate "SYNPROXY target support"
depends on NF_CONNTRACK && NETFILTER_ADVANCED
select NETFILTER_SYNPROXY
- select SYN_COOKIES
+ select NF_SYNPROXY
help
The SYNPROXY target allows you to intercept TCP connections and
establish them using syncookies before they are passed on to the
diff --git a/net/netfilter/Kconfig b/net/netfilter/Kconfig
index 02b281d3c167..ae65fca0d509 100644
--- a/net/netfilter/Kconfig
+++ b/net/netfilter/Kconfig
@@ -435,6 +435,10 @@ config NF_NAT_REDIRECT
config NF_NAT_MASQUERADE
bool
+config NF_SYNPROXY
+ tristate
+ depends on NF_CONNTRACK && NETFILTER_ADVANCED
+
config NETFILTER_SYNPROXY
tristate
diff --git a/net/netfilter/Makefile b/net/netfilter/Makefile
index 72cca6b48960..7a6067513eee 100644
--- a/net/netfilter/Makefile
+++ b/net/netfilter/Makefile
@@ -67,6 +67,7 @@ obj-$(CONFIG_NF_NAT_TFTP) += nf_nat_tftp.o
# SYNPROXY
obj-$(CONFIG_NETFILTER_SYNPROXY) += nf_synproxy_core.o
+obj-$(CONFIG_NF_SYNPROXY) += nf_synproxy.o
obj-$(CONFIG_NETFILTER_CONNCOUNT) += nf_conncount.o
--
2.20.1